FAQs:
What is the tube material used in the TEMA AES Stabilized Gasoline Cooler?
The cooler uses SA179 carbon steel tubes, known for their high thermal conductivity, seamless construction, and pressure resistance.
How is the cooler tested for performance and reliability?
The cooler undergoes hydraulic testing at 1.5× design pressure per ASME Sec VIII to ensure leak-free and pressure-resistant performance.
What industries commonly use the TEMA AES Stabilized Gasoline Cooler?
The cooler is widely used in petrochemical plants, oil refineries, power plants, and the chemical industry for cooling stabilized gasoline and other hydrocarbon-based applications.
